Abstract

The utility model relates to the technical field of USB automatic production equipment, and discloses a USB pin header conveying, cutting and pin inserting three-in-one device. The device comprises a working table, and a transferring mechanism, a cutting mechanism and a pin inserting mechanism which are sequentially arranged on the working table, a guide jig is further arranged on the workbench. The transferring mechanism comprises a displacement block installed at the output end of the transferring mechanism, the cutting mechanism comprises a positioning block and a cutter which are installed at the output end of the cutting mechanism, and the needle inserting mechanism comprises a clamp installed at the output end of the needle inserting mechanism. The guide jig comprises a guide base and a guide upper cover arranged above the guide base, a guide groove is formed between the guide base and the guide upper cover, and the pin header is arranged in the guide groove; and a first clearance position, a second clearance position and a third clearance position are arranged on the guide upper cover. The USB pin header conveying, cutting and pin inserting three-in-one device is arranged to be of an integrated structure, on one hand, the manufacturing cost of USB production equipment is reduced; and on the other hand, the efficiency of the USB pin inserting process is improved.

Technical Field

[0001] This utility model relates to the field of USB automated production equipment technology, specifically a three-in-one device for conveying, cutting and inserting USB pin headers. Background Technology

[0002] USB is a serial bus standard and an input / output interface technology specification, widely used in personal computers and mobile devices, and extending to other related fields such as photographic equipment, digital televisions, and game consoles. The manufacturing process of a USB connector includes assembling the pins and the casing; before the pin insertion process, the pin header needs to be fed and cut to the target number of pins before inserting the cut pins into the silicone core.

[0003] In existing USB terminal production equipment, the pin conveying device, the cutting device, and the pin insertion device are all set up separately and perform their respective functions independently. In other words, multiple devices are required to cooperate to realize the pin insertion process of USB terminals, resulting in high manufacturing costs and low pin insertion efficiency of USB production equipment.

[0004] Therefore, there is an urgent need for a three-in-one device for USB header pin delivery, cutting off, and insertion to solve the above problems. Utility Model Content

[0005] Based on the above, the purpose of this utility model is to provide a three-in-one device for conveying, cutting and inserting USB pin headers, so as to solve the problems of high manufacturing cost and low pin insertion efficiency of existing USB production equipment.

[0038] like Figure 1-6As shown, this utility model provides a three-in-one device for conveying, cutting, and inserting USB pin headers 10. The device includes a workbench 1, on which a transfer mechanism, a cutting mechanism 4, and a pin insertion mechanism 5 are sequentially mounted. The transfer mechanism includes a displacement block 30 mounted at its output end; the cutting mechanism 4 includes a positioning block 40 and a cutter 41 mounted at its output end; and the pin insertion mechanism 5 includes a clamp 50 mounted at its output end. A guide fixture 2 is mounted on the workbench 1 and located below the output ends of the transfer mechanism, the cutting mechanism 4, and the pin insertion mechanism 5. The guide fixture 2 includes a guide base. The guide base 20 and the guide cover 21 are mounted on the guide base 20. A guide groove 213 is formed between the guide base 20 and the guide cover 21. The pin 10 is placed in the guide groove 213. The guide cover 21 is provided with a first clearance position 210, a second clearance position 211 and a third clearance position 212. The displacement block 30 is provided in the first clearance position 210, which can move up, down and left and right. The positioning block 40 and the cutter 41 are provided in the second clearance position 211 and the third clearance position 212, which can move up and down. The clamp 50 is provided on the side of the cutter 41 away from the guide cover 21.

[0039] This utility model provides a three-in-one device for conveying, cutting, and inserting USB pin headers 10. The pin header 10 is placed in the guide groove 213. The pressing cylinder 322 drives the displacement block 30 to move downward. The limiting rod 301 is inserted into the material strip limiting hole of the pin header 10. The displacement cylinder 31 drives the displacement block 30 to move towards the cutting mechanism 4, thus moving the pin header 10 to below the output end of the cutting mechanism 4. At this time, the first lifting cylinder 42 drives the positioning block 40 and the cutter 41 to move downward simultaneously, realizing the pressing and positioning of the pin header 10 and the cutting action. At the same time, the second lifting cylinder 54 drives the clamp 50 to close and clamp the cut pin header 10. Finally, the inserting cylinder 52 moves the cut pin header 10 forward and inserts it into the rubber core to complete the inserting process of the rubber core. The USB pin header 10's integrated conveying, cutting, and insertion device combines the transfer mechanism, cutting mechanism 4, and insertion mechanism 5 into a single structure, thereby reducing the manufacturing cost of USB production equipment and improving the efficiency of the USB pin insertion process.

[0040] In this embodiment, as Figure 2 and Figure 4As shown, the transfer mechanism includes a displacement cylinder 31, a first sliding assembly 32, and a support frame 33. The displacement cylinder 31 is fixed to the worktable 1 via a mounting base. The first sliding assembly 32 includes a first slide rail 320 mounted on the side of the guide base 20 and a first slider 321 slidably mounted on the first slide rail 320. One end of the first slider 321 is connected to the displacement cylinder 31. The support frame 33 is mounted on the top of the first slider 321, and a longitudinal groove is provided on the side of the support frame 33 near the displacement block 30. The displacement block 30 is slidably disposed in the groove. A pressing cylinder 322 is mounted on the top of the support frame 33, and a drive connecting block 323 connects the pressing cylinder 322 and the displacement block 30. In this structure, the first slider 321 is driven to move on the first slide rail 320 by the telescopic movement of the displacement cylinder 31, thereby driving the displacement block 30 to reciprocate along the axis of the guide fixture 2; thus, when the pressing cylinder 322 performs telescopic movement, it drives the displacement block 30 to move up and down; the bottom of the displacement block 30 is provided with at least two limiting rods 301, and in this embodiment, it is preferable to provide two limiting rods 301; in the above structure, the displacement block 30 is driven to move downward by the pressing cylinder 322, at this time, the limiting rods 301 move downward and are inserted into the material strip insertion hole of the needle row 10 to limit the needle row 10, and the movement and conveying of the needle row 10 is realized by the displacement cylinder 31 driving the displacement block 30 to move in the direction of the cutting mechanism 4.

[0041] In this embodiment, as Figure 2 and Figure 5As shown, the cutting mechanism 4 includes a first lifting cylinder 42, a first linkage assembly 43, and a guide block 44; the first linkage assembly 43 includes a first "Y"-shaped support rod 431 vertically mounted on the worktable 1 and a first connecting rod 432 connected to the first "Y"-shaped support rod 431, with "U"-shaped connecting blocks 433 rotatably mounted at both ends of the first connecting rod 432; the guide block 44 is vertically mounted on the worktable 1, and a sliding groove is provided on the guide block 44, in which a guide plate 440 that can move up and down is fitted, and a clearance hole is provided on the worktable 1 below the guide plate 440, with the bottom end of the guide plate 440 rotatably passing through the clearance hole; two "U"-shaped connecting blocks 433 are respectively connected to the side of the first lifting cylinder 42 and the top of the guide plate 440; wherein, the first connecting rod 432 and the first "Y"-shaped support rod 431 are connected to the first "Y"-shaped support rod 431 vertically mounted on the worktable 1, and a first "Y"-shaped connecting block 432 connected to the first "Y"-shaped support rod 431. The Y-shaped support rod 431 and the U-shaped connecting block 433 are rotatably connected by a pivot pin. A drive plate 441 is installed at the top of the guide plate 440, and the positioning block 40 and the cutter 41 are respectively connected to the bottom of the drive plate 441. That is to say, the first lifting cylinder 42 drives the first linkage component 43 through the lever principle to drive the positioning block 40 and the cutter 41 to move up and down at the same time to press down, position and cut the needle row 10. An adjusting screw 442 is also threaded on the drive plate 441, and a positioning nut 443 is threaded on the adjusting screw 442. The cutter 41 is connected to the bottom of the adjusting screw 442. By rotating the adjusting screw 442, the up and down position of the cutter 41 can be adjusted to meet the spacing of the needle row 10 in the subsequent cutting operation and ensure that the needle row 10 can be effectively cut.

[0042] Further, such as Figure 3 As shown, the first clearance position 210 is a long strip-shaped through hole, and the displacement block 30 can move left and right in the through hole to realize the conveying displacement of the needle row 10.

[0043] In this embodiment, as Figure 1 and Figure 6As shown, the pin insertion mechanism 5 includes a second sliding assembly 51 mounted on the worktable 1 and a pin insertion cylinder 52 connected to the second sliding assembly 51; a second linkage assembly 53 and a second lifting cylinder 54 are mounted on the second sliding assembly 51. The second sliding assembly 51 includes a second slide rail 510 mounted on the worktable 1 and a second slider 511 mounted on the second slide rail 510, one end of which is connected to the output end of the pin insertion cylinder 52; the second linkage assembly 53 includes a second "Y"-shaped support rod 530 vertically fixed to the second slider 511 and a hollow block 531 mounted on the second "Y"-shaped support rod 530; the hollow block 531 is movably sleeved on the second "Y"-shaped support rod 530; a second connecting rod 532 is connected to the top end of the second "Y"-shaped support rod 530, one end of which is connected to the hollow block 531, and the other end is connected to the output end of the second lifting cylinder 54. The hollow block 531 is driven to move up and down on the second "Y"-shaped support rod 530 by the extension and retraction of the second lifting cylinder 54.

[0044] Specifically, the fixture 50 includes a lower clamping block 502 connected to the second slider 511 and an upper clamping block 501 connected to the hollow block 531. When the pins 10 are conveyed to the lower part of the cutting mechanism 4 under the drive of the transfer mechanism 3, the initial end of the pins 10 extends outward toward one end of the guide fixture 2. At this time, the second lifting cylinder 54 drives the upper clamping block 501 to close toward the lower clamping block 502 and clamps the extended pins 10. After the cutting mechanism 4 cuts the pins 10, the pin insertion cylinder 52 drives the fixture 50 holding the pins 10 to move forward and insert the pins 10 into the core, completing the pin insertion process of the core. This structure is simple and has high pin insertion efficiency. In actual production applications, it reduces the manufacturing cost of USB production equipment while improving the pin insertion efficiency of the core.
